Support Your Gut with These Vital Vitamins
Your gut microbiome is a complex ecosystem of trillions of bacteria, fungi, and viruses that play a vital role in your overall health. Supporting a diverse and balanced microbiome is crucial for strong digestion, immune function, mental well-being, and even weight management. While a diverse diet rich in fiber and prebiotics is fundamental, certain vitamins can strengthen the growth of beneficial bacteria in your gut and contribute to its overall health.
- Vitamin A: Plays a key role in immune system function.
- Vitamin B12: Essential for energy metabolism, and its deficiency can impact gut bacteria balance.
- Vitamin D: Studies suggest it may have a positive influence on the composition of gut microbes.
Getting these essential vitamins through your diet or supplements can be a powerful way to support a thriving gut microbiome and reap its numerous health benefits.
